資源描述:
《php直接讀取數(shù)據(jù)庫(kù)信息的三種方法--》由會(huì)員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在應(yīng)用文檔-天天文庫(kù)。
1、php直接讀取數(shù)據(jù)庫(kù)信息的三種方法>>這段代碼的功能是:連接到一個(gè)url地址為localhost、端口為3306的mysql服務(wù)器上。mysql服務(wù)器的帳號(hào)是"root",密碼是"9999"。mysql服務(wù)器上有一個(gè)數(shù)據(jù)庫(kù)ok,數(shù)據(jù)庫(kù)里有一個(gè)表abc。表abc一共為兩列,列名分別是"id"和"name",將abc里的所有數(shù)據(jù)讀出來。以下為引用的內(nèi)容:<?$dbh=mysql_connect("localhost:3306","root","9999");/*定義變量dbh,mysql_connect()函數(shù)的意思是連接mysql數(shù)據(jù)庫(kù),"
2、"的意思是屏蔽報(bào)錯(cuò)*/if(!$dbh){die("error");}/*die()函數(shù)的意思是將括號(hào)里的字串送到瀏覽器并中斷PHP程式(Script)。括號(hào)里的參數(shù)為欲送出的字串。*/mysql_select_db("ok",$dbh);/*選擇mysql服務(wù)器里的一個(gè)數(shù)據(jù)庫(kù),這里選的數(shù)據(jù)庫(kù)名為ok*/$q="SELECT*FROMabc";/*定義變量q,"SELECT*FROMabc"是一個(gè)SQL語(yǔ)句,意思是讀取表abc中的數(shù)據(jù)*/?><br/><!--=========方法一=========--><br/><?
3、$rs=mysql_query($q,$dbh);/*定義變量rs,函數(shù)mysql_query()的意思是:送出query字串供MySQL做相關(guān)的處理或者執(zhí)行.由于php是從右往左執(zhí)行的,所以,rs的值是服務(wù)器運(yùn)行mysql_query()函數(shù)后返回的值*/if(!$rs){die("Validresult!");}echo"<table>";echo"<tr><td>ID</td><td>Name</td></tr>";ysql_fetch_roysql_fetch_roysql_query($q,$
4、dbh);ysql_fetch_object($rs))echo"$roe<br/>";/*id和name可以換位置*/?><br/><!--=========方法三=========--><br/><?$rs=mysql_query($q,$dbh);ysql_fetch_array($rs))echo"$roe]<br/>";/*id和name可以換位置*/?><!--=========方法三最快=========--><?mysql_close($dbh);/*關(guān)閉到mysql數(shù)據(jù)庫(kù)的連接*
5、/?>>>>>這篇文章來自..,。